Audio is hot right now, with more listeners than ever tuning in (1) to podcasts and other services. Streaming audio is now an industry worth more than $12 billion, thanks to regular yearly growth, and podcasting alone attracts more than 100 million monthly users in the US. Understanding where this market is headed (and how to capitalize on it) means understanding where we came from. We’ve traced out the history of sound recording technology and illustrated the major milestones so you can see how far we’ve come.
